A Chicago man recorded goodbye messages for his wife and children after spending hours stranded inside a giant gas station sign suspended more than 130 feet off the ground.
Electrician A.J. Gow was working on the truck stop sign in Wilmington, Illinois, on July 21 when a mechanical failure left him fearing for his life.
‘In the moment, it was getting hairy, I was genuinely getting scared, and I didn’t know what was going to happen. And yeah, I was freaking out,’ he said, relaying the incident to ABC7 Chicago.
